如何向EXISTING Datatable添加行

时间:2010-12-27 23:19:58

标签: asp.net sql vb.net-2010

我的Visual Basic 2010 Express解决方案中有一个sql数据库(agentroster.sdf),我已经能够使用数据表创建数据源(AGENT_ROSTER)。据我所知,这一切都有效。

但是,我正在尝试从ROSTER.xaml.vb向此现有数据表(以及数据库)添加一个新行,该行与数据库位于同一项目中。我还需要删除记录,并将记录的值加载到一组变量中,这些变量稍后将在更改后写回。这个系统对我的特定项目来说是必要的。

但是,我无法弄清楚如何在这个EXISTING数据表中创建一个新行。我已经确认了连接和所有内容,我不想在现有连接之上创建一个全新的连接。

帮助?

1 个答案:

答案 0 :(得分:1)

在C#中你可以做类似的事情:

    var table = new DataTable();
    var row = table.NewRow();
    table.Rows.Add(row);

当然,表此时基本上是空的,但如果你的数据表来自数据库,那么它已经有了模式,新行将匹配它的模式。